Detection of Left Atrial Myopathy Using Artificial Intelligence-Enabled Electrocardiography

Frederik H. Verbrugge et al.

Summary: A novel AI-enabled ECG score can identify underlying LA myopathy in patients with heart failure and preserved ejection fraction based on analysis of 12-lead ECG. This score is associated with structural, functional, and hemodynamic abnormalities, as well as long-term risk for incident AF. Further research is needed to determine the role of AI-enabled ECG in the evaluation and care of patients with heart failure and preserved ejection fraction.
